The location in Skookumchuck, British Columbia, Canada, is seeking talent to fill the position of Electrical Supervisor. This job is full-time permanent.

Under the general direction of the Mechanical Superintendent, the Electrical/Instrumentation Maintenance Supervisor is responsible for the maintenance, repair, and installation of the mill Electrical/Instrument equipment, support systems, buildings, and services, ensuring maximum availability of equipment in support of quality and production.

AREAS OF RESPONSIBILITY

  • Establishes maintenance needs and priorities with the assistance of Maintenance Planners, Reliability Supervisor, and Area Supervisors to minimize production losses. Supervises the Planning and implementation of daily maintenance, preventative maintenance, and shutdown maintenance. Reports on equipment failure and remedial service plans.
  • Responsible for leading, directing, and controlling maintenance crews to ensure their daily planned maintenance objectives, safety performance, environmental compliance, government regulations, and insurance requirements are satisfied.
  • Monitors equipment condition, anticipates potential failures, and formulates solutions. Deploys project engineers to troubleshoot and form a plan then ensures tradesmen are deployed to perform needed work.
  • Participates in recruiting, training, and development of Electrical/Instrumentation Personnel. Liaises as required with union representatives to resolve grievances. May sit on apprenticeship selection committee.
  • Works with other Maintenance Department staff to develop area maintenance and capital budgets, prioritizes spending, and advise management on cost over-runs and extraordinary equipment restrictions.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Grade 12 or equivalent
  • Valid trades qualification or relevant Engineering Degree
  • Minimum 2 years experience as a front-line supervisor or related maintenance experience • Understanding of mill-wide mechanical equipment
  • Familiarity with pulp process and related equipment
  • Supervisory Training
  • Budgeting and financial familiarization
